In mid-2022, the COVID-19 cases have reached close to 562 million, but its overall infection rate is hard to confirm. Even with effective vaccines, break-through infections with new variants occur, and safe and reliable testing still plays a critical role in isolation of infected individuals and in control of an outbreak of a COVID-19 pandemic. In response to this urgent need, the diagnostic tests for COVID-19 are rapidly evolving and improving these days. The health authorities of many countries issued requirements for detecting SARS-CoV-2 diagnosis tests during the pandemic and have timely access to these tests to ensure safety and effectiveness. In this study, we compared the requirements of EUA in Taiwan, Singapore, and the United States. For the performance evaluations of nucleic acid extraction, inclusivity, limit of detection (LoD), cross-reactivity, interference, cutoff, and stability, the requirements are similar in the three countries. The use of natural clinical specimens is needed for clinical evaluation in Taiwan and the United States. However, carry-over and cross-contamination studies can be exempted in Taiwan and the United States but are required in Singapore. This review outlines requirements and insight to guide the test developers on the development of IVDs. Considering the rapidly evolving viruses and severe pandemic of COVID-19, timely and accurate diagnostic testing is imperative to the management of diseases. As noted above, the performance requirements for SARS-CoV-2 nucleic acid tests are similar between Taiwan, Singapore and the United States. The differences are mainly in two points: the recommended microorganisms for cross-reactivity study, and the specimen requirement for clinical evaluation. This study provides an overview of current requirements of SARS-CoV-2 nucleic acid tests in Taiwan, Singapore, and the United States.

INTRODUCTION: In Taiwan, In Vitro Diagnostic Medical Device (IVD) is regulated as medical device since 1987, and the implementation of IVD registration was fully completed in 2005. The management system of IVD medical device is highly similar with a guidance 'The GHTF Regulatory Model' developed by Global Harmonization Task Force (GHTF) in 2011 for use of regulation development on medical devices. Area covered: In this study, the Regulatory Model developed by GHTF was compared with Taiwanese IVD management system and it has shown that these two regulatory frameworks are highly similar. Expert commentary: The experience of IVD management in Taiwan can serve a strong evidence to prove the feasibility and effectiveness of GHTF Regulatory Model.

INTRODUCTION: With the aging of the post-war baby boomer generation, the increasing demands for healthcare are driving the growth of medical industry and development of new products in order to meet the immense needs from the aging population. However, medical devices are designed to maintain the health and safety of people, therefore, medical devices are undergoing rigorous management by competent health authorities in all countries. In recent years, Asian countries have been reforming their regulations and standards for medical devices with substantial changes. AREAS COVERED: The study is a summary of the framework of medical device regulations in Asian countries, including Asian Harmonization Working Party (AHWP), Japan, China, Taiwan, South Korea, India and Singapore. Expert commentary: Asian countries are constantly reforming their medical device regulations. The emergence of brand-new technology and quality management issues arose by global manufacturing have imposed difficulties in harmonizing and reaching consensus between countries. The third-party conformity assessment system for medical devices can reduce the costs for competent health authorities and shorten the review time, which could facilitate the feasibility of harmonization of medical device regulations.
